
Five Bluefish Named to All-Star Game
Published on July 3, 2013 under Atlantic League (AtL)
Bridgeport Bluefish News Release
Bridgeport, Conn. - Bridgeport Bluefish team officials today announced that five members of the team have been selected to participate in the 2013 Atlantic League All-Star Game. Pitchers Jeff Fulchino and Kanekoa Texeira will be joined by infielder Daniel Mayora, outfielder Austin Krum, and catcher Yusuf Carter on the Liberty Division squad.
"We are very pleased to have these five players represent the Bluefish during the 2013 Atlantic League All-Star Game," says Bluefish general manager Ken Shepard. "They have been key members of our team during the first half of the season and are deserving of this accomplishment."
Mayora has impressed during his first tour in the Park City as he ranks second in the Atlantic League in hits (89), fourth in at-bats (272) and doubles (19), and sixth in batting average (.327). He also leads the team in all of those categories while scoring 37 runs, stealing 10 bases and posting a .372 on-base percentage. Krum, in his first season with the ball club, is batting .318 (ninth in the Atlantic League) with two home runs, three triples, 14 doubles, 26 RBI, and 37 runs scored. Carter makes his first All-Star team during his third year in the Atlantic League and first with the âFish. He has slugged a team-high seven home runs, while recording a .301 batting average with seven doubles, 19 RBI and 15 runs scored, while carrying a .929 OPS.
Fulchino and Texeira have been the top contributors for the Bluefish pitching staff in the bullpen. Fulchino, during his first year in the Atlantic League, owns a 1-0 record with a sparkling 0.90 ERA, 23 punchouts and seven saves over the course of 20 innings of work. Texeira, also during his Atlantic League debut, has posted a 3-2 record with a 3.18 ERA and 16 strikeouts in a team-high 34 innings pitched out of the bullpen.
Mayora, Krum, Carter, Fulchino Texeira will represent the Bluefish on the Liberty Division squad managed by Long Island skipper Kevin Baez at the 2013 All-Star Game, which takes place July 10 at Regency Furniture Stadium, home of the Southern Maryland Blue Crabs, in Waldorf, Maryland. All-Star selections were the results of fan, media and front office polling, which took place throughout the league and individual team web sites.
